Battery Life
There’s plenty of technology packed into the thermal scope, and it’s must have some type of battery to run it. All batteries are not created equal, and so you need to ensure the battery in your thermal scope will stay powered up for the time you need it. It is important to consider how long you plan to use the scope for in one session, how long does it take to charge, and what do extra batteries run.

Size/Weight
Thermal imaging scopes are huge and heavy. Average weight for a standard thermal rifle scope is about 2 pounds. Lightweight thermals weigh around 1-1.5 pounds, which is equivalent to regular morning rifle scopes. Although thermals may be around the same size as traditional rifle scopes, and even shorter, the internal components needed to provide thermal imaging makes them wider. Their overall size and weight can affect your hunting or tactical weapon and scope system.
An option that is lightweight and compact is to look into a clip-on system. Not only does it shed weight and size, but they’re made to work as a front-facing scope and are easily removable and attachable.
Operation Range
Thermals can give you more than 1000 yards of detection range on targets, regardless of day as well as night conditions. However the distance that you can identify and recognize what you are looking for will be much shorter.
The ranges of these will differ between manufacturers, models, and quality. The thermal detector’s sensitivity will be the prime factor you will want to research. A higher magnification will help quickly recognize and identify distant targets, however it may also lead to poor pixelation, resulting in a blurred image. Night Vision
Night vision operates by taking light or reflections of light and then transforming them to create an image that is crystal clear.
Therefore, it needs some sort of ambient light for its operation.
If you’re shooting at night the moon’s light and stars usually provide enough light. Modern models have infrared illuminators which function like flashlights to illuminate the scope however they aren’t visible to the naked eye.
If you’re looking through markets to purchase night vision optics there are three rating for these – Gen I, II, or III. In simple terms, the more the grade, the better the quality.
You’ll also see a newer class of night vision scopes called Digital Night Vision.
The normal night vision displays the traditional black and green as the new digital night vision is usually presented in white and black across the screen of the LCD.

Thermal Imaging
Thermal scopes detect heat or radiation given off by any living object. Thermal imaging employs a specific kind of lens that focuses upon infrared light and creates a thermogram. How long does the Thermal Scope last?
On average, thermal scopes run for about eight hours with a single charge. Different models last from 2 and 10 hours. More recently, ATN has managed to create ultra-low consumption thermal scopes that can provide 10+ hours of continuous usage.
Why do Thermal Scopes cost so much?
It is generally true that thermal scopes cost a lot due to advanced technological components. There are also price differences in the various features like Bluetooth connectivity and palette mods or ballistic applications, and more. However, thermals start at a sensible price of $1000.
How Far can Thermal Rifle Scopes See?
The distance thermal rifle scopes can see is contingent on factors like display resolution and the magnification setting. Generally, even low-end thermals will detect heat signals up to 1,000+ yards. Top-quality thermals are able to detect heat signatures that extend beyond 4,000 yards, but target identification is another matter.
